Although PVC vertical blinds can be a simple addition to your current home decor, some issues have arisen regarding their durability and eco-friendliness. The off gassing, or agent-release, during the production of PVC is one of the main concerns. This is just a general area of concern with PVC; if you have not had any problems in the past, there is little probability that you will have a problem with your vertical blinds. There have been some issues of discoloration and brittleness with PVC that is often attributed to indirect contact from the sun's light. This problem is usually avoided with higher quality PVC.
Fabric vertical blinds are available in a vast array of colors, and they can complement many home decorating schemes. There are low cost, stitchbonded fabric options when it comes to vertical blinds, and for a slightly higher investment, you can get ones that are made out of woven fabrics which can be used to enhance the decor of your home. Absorbing the extra cost to get nicer, woven fabric vertical blinds, will actually be an investment that pays off in the long run.
